Reloaded-II项目中ASI加载器丢失的解决方案
问题背景
在使用Reloaded-II模组加载器为P3R(Persona 3 Reload)游戏安装模组时,用户可能会遇到模组无法正常工作的情况。这种情况通常是由于游戏目录中的关键文件Reloaded.Mod.Bootstrapper.asi被误删所致。该文件是Reloaded-II框架的核心组件之一,负责在游戏启动时加载模组。
问题分析
Reloaded.Mod.Bootstrapper.asi文件是Reloaded-II框架的ASI加载器,它的作用类似于一个桥梁,连接游戏主程序和模组系统。当这个文件缺失时,游戏将无法识别和加载任何通过Reloaded-II安装的模组,导致模组功能完全失效。
解决方案
要恢复ASI加载器并重新启用模组功能,可以按照以下步骤操作:
- 打开Reloaded-II应用程序
- 在界面中找到并选择对应的游戏配置
- 点击"编辑应用程序"(Edit Application)菜单
- 在选项中找到并执行"部署ASI加载器"(Deploy ASI Loader)功能
这个操作会自动在游戏目录中重新生成必要的Reloaded.Mod.Bootstrapper.asi文件,恢复模组加载功能。
注意事项
如果按照上述步骤操作后问题仍未解决,可能需要考虑以下额外步骤:
- 检查游戏目录的写入权限,确保Reloaded-II有权限创建文件
- 验证游戏完整性,确保其他核心文件没有损坏
- 检查防病毒软件设置,确保没有误拦截ASI加载器的创建或运行
技术原理
ASI(Alterative Script Injector)是一种常见的游戏模组加载机制。Reloaded-II通过ASI加载器在游戏启动时注入自己的模组管理系统,这套系统相比传统ASI提供了更强大的模组管理能力和兼容性。当ASI加载器缺失时,整个注入流程就会中断,导致模组无法加载。
总结
Reloaded-II框架的稳定性依赖于几个关键组件,其中ASI加载器是最基础的部分。用户在遇到模组不工作的问题时,首先应该检查这些核心文件是否存在且完整。通过简单的重新部署操作,大多数情况下都能快速恢复模组功能。如果问题持续存在,则可能需要更深入的故障排查。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



